This week everything you wanted to know about the TACP Officer career field.

 

On this week's episode of the Ones Ready podcast we have Tactical Air Control Party Officer (TACPO) Capt Tyler Quinn. Capt Quinn has been in the TACP world for the last 17 years and was originally enlisted before taking his expertise to the dark side. During this episode we will discuss what TACPOs do, what TACPO deployments are like, and how they integrate with the big green Army machine. We also discuss some changes to TACPO assessment and the new swimming requirements for the TACP career field. And finally you know that Weapons School was brought up as well as the day to day life of a TACPO and critical skills that each candidate should have.
